Output b65203d24006b1266a4e577d049c34e8c52cf62a8f6807ada2c41c951787896e:4

value
111668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 880a00d0683b5f6c1f03a6ef81ae6846b114a83a OP_EQUAL
address
3E6Kofa65XcrBYGDMymCYiG9pQgFnYqRpZ
transaction
b65203d24006b1266a4e577d049c34e8c52cf62a8f6807ada2c41c951787896e
confirmations
230403
spent
true